‘Media Day’ showcases ‘creative economy’

"Media Day '10" in the Capitol on Tuesday included displays showcasing parts of Idaho's "creative economy," from filmmaking to video games. (Betsy Russell)

There's lots of high-tech film equipment up on the fourth floor rotunda today at "Media Day '10," which is showcasing media innovation and technology. Exhibits cover everything from university film programs to a screenwriters' group to other aspects of the "creative economy." As part of the event, a special screening is planned at the Egyptian Theater tonight at 7 of "After the Storm," an award-winning documentary from the Priddy Brothers described as "a celebration of perseverance and rebirth through the arts." The screening costs $10, or $5 for students; the exhibits in the Capitol are free for viewing from 8 to 4 today.
